JAK2 V617F hematopoietic clones are present several years prior to MPN diagnosis and follow different expansion kinetics

TO THE EDITOR: The JAK2 V617F mutation is the most common somatic mutation in the classical myeloproliferative neoplasms (MPNs), present in >95% of cases of polycythemia vera (PV) and ∼50% of essential thrombocythemia (ET) and myelofibrosis (MF).1⇓⇓-4 It is usually the sole identifiable driver mutation in MPNs5 and was recently also identified as a driver of age-related clonal hemopoiesis in healthy...
